    Had that problem. Run it out as far as you can On the outside of your rig, unscrew the 1 screw holding the motor. Inside, lift motor out of gear drive. (Which ever side is easiest to access), Measure and align the slide to equal or square with your wall. Drop motor into gear drive. Outside run screw back in to secure motor. On the slide controller, unplug the power lead, wait 30 sec and plug it back in. Hopefully it will clear codes and reset. Run your slide all out, then all in a few times. Always holding the botton and continuing to hold after it stops for 3 to 5 seconds...always. this fixed mine after the dealer told me both motors needed replacing along with the control board. Go figure. Hope this works for you.

    We had a similar problem with our slide. A technician suggested when retracting or extending, when finished continue to hold in on the power button for 5 seconds. Our issue was also on extending. So, when retracting I kept holding in on the power button for 5 seconds after it was fully retracted. That fixed our issue. So, now I do the five second hold for both retracting and extending. This is only on our Schwintek slide. Apparently it allowed the motors to sync.

    we had the exact same issue with our slide in our reflection 320MKS. You don't say which slide it is so I'll give our run down quickly:
    1. The bed in our bedroom slide had three rollers underneath. When the slide went in and out, I had noticed during the warranty period that it looked like the marks on the carpet weren't the same so I brought it up when we took it in for warranty work. They said nothing wrong.
    2. Skip one year, the bedroom slide failed to go out all the way, no matter what we did, including using the emergency reset under the belly.
    3. We took it back into our dealer to find out what had happened, and was told that because the rollers weren't placed in proper position, the slide was moving in and out "just slightly off track".
    4. this resulted in stress on the one rail, which when they took at look at the dealership, snapped in their hands.
    5. The dealer told us it would be handled by our extended warranty, but I stood my ground and stated that (and had the proof) that I had brought this to their attention last year when it was under warranty, so I was darn well not paying or using my warranty to pay for their mistake.
    6. Head office Grand Design authorized the work to be done. didn't cost us anything.

    We got our 2021 260RD in late September and had a similar issue with the slide. Ended up having to have parts replaced.

    Being new to the RV life, we didn't know what sound to expect when opening the slide. Granted, it wasn't nearly as loud as the video you posted, but it did sound a bit loud. We consistently did the "hold for 5 seconds" upon opening and closing, as we were told by the dealer. We made it thru a 5-week trip, with many stops, successfully.

    Fast forward a couple weeks to late December, as we were getting prepared to go out on our next trip, suddenly the slide would not open without manually giving it a good shove. In looking at the rails, we could see significant wear in sections.

    The dealership was backed up for months with service appointments, but when we explained we only have ~2 weeks before we leave for a multi-month trip and we can't use the bathroom or bedroom with the slide closed, they were fantastic to work with. Kudos to Beckley's RV in Thurmont, MD, and Mike in service. He had us bring it in the next morning early and they said "one side seems like its skipping. Teeth are broken on the side rail and lots of metal shavings, top gear also sounds like teeth are broken as it runs".

    They would need to order replacement parts for the slide column and the rail to fix it. The parts are big and heavy so had to be shipped by freight which took a just under a week to arrive. Mike got us in the next day and turned around the repairs within two days. Just in time for us to hit the road on our trip.

    With the new parts installed, the slide sounds much better, not silent but not grinding so loudly. Hoping it continues to work smoothly from now on.
